Drohendes Aus für search_wordmatch

Probleme bei der regulären Arbeiten mit phpBB, Fragen zu Vorgehensweisen oder Funktionsweise sowie sonstige Fragen zu phpBB im Allgemeinen.
Forumsregeln
phpBB 2.0 hat das Ende seiner Lebenszeit überschritten
phpBB 2.0 wird nicht mehr aktiv unterstützt. Insbesondere werden - auch bei Sicherheitslücken - keine Patches mehr bereitgestellt. Der Einsatz von phpBB 2.0 erfolgt daher auf eigene Gefahr. Wir empfehlen einen Umstieg auf phpBB 3.1, welches aktiv weiterentwickelt wird und für welches regelmäßig Updates zur Verfügung gestellt werden.
Antworten
Maran
Mitglied
Beiträge: 24
Registriert: 14.07.2004 14:52

Drohendes Aus für search_wordmatch

Beitrag von Maran »

Hallo Leute,

ich habe das Problem, dass sich zu viele Suchwörter in meiner Datenbank befinden. Mitlerweile sind es bereits über 10 Millionen. Da die ID-Spalte auf MEDIUMINT( 8 ) gesetzt ist und damit das Maximum bei etwa 16 Millionen erreicht sein wird, mache ich mir Sorgen, dass mein Forum Ende diesen Jahres meine Datenbank "sprengt".
Wie kann ich dagegen vorgehen?
Einfach alle MEDIUMINTs auf INT setzen?

:)
Benutzeravatar
larsneo
Mitglied
Beiträge: 2622
Registriert: 07.03.2002 15:23
Wohnort: schwäbisch gmünd
Kontaktdaten:

Beitrag von larsneo »

zuerst einmal würde ich eine bessere stopwords.txt empfehlen [1] - damit sollte sich dann auch die datenbankgrösse deutlich verringern. die neuerstellung des index bei derart umfangreichen tabellen ist allerdings nicht zu unterschätzen...
die änderung des typs sollte darüberhinaus aber eigentlich problemlos möglich sein...

neugierige frage: nachdem ich im nuforum bei rund 160.000 beiträgen nur knapp 300.000 einträge in der wordlist habe - um welches forum geht es bei dir?

[1] siehe auch http://www.phpbb.de/doku/kb/artikel.php?artikel=32
gruesse aus dem wilden sueden
larsneo
..::[krapohl.net]::..
Maran
Mitglied
Beiträge: 24
Registriert: 14.07.2004 14:52

Beitrag von Maran »

Danke für den Tipp. Habs gerade durchgeführt mit folgendem Ergebnis:
30% der Einträge aus search_wordmatch gelöscht (von 10 auf 7 Mio.)

Immerhin. Dies wird die "Sprengung" trotzdem nicht sehr viel länger aufhalten. Dann also doch auf INT setzen?

:)
Antworten

Zurück zu „phpBB 2.0: Administration, Benutzung und Betrieb“